Posted By: BMWConv99
Date Posted: 20-April-2007 at 13:55

Hiya, I put a post up on the 3 series, My 99 318i E36 had a flickering digital air con display, I was kindly given this link, tried it and worked prefect and still is, don't know if it exactly the same as your E30 but defo worth a shot, cost me exactly 50cent to replace te capacititor- the main culprit of these problems.

http://www.macadamizer.com/bmwfix.html - http://www.macadamizer.com/bmwfix.html

Check it out, see what you think
